NATO Secretary General to visit Georgia

N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g has announced he will visit Georgia this autumn.

Today at the second day of Warsaw Summit, NATO leaders agreed a set of decisions to project stability beyond the Alliance’s borders, RIA Novosti reported.

"We have recognized the progress Georgia has achieved on its path to membership,” Stoltenberg said.
